Saveetha School of Law, Chennai, successfully organised a National Conference on *“Women’s Challenges in India: Law, Society, and Empowerment”* on *10 July 2026* in hybrid mode.
The Department of Research and Development and the Centre for Criminal Justice Research (CCJR), Saveetha School of Law, SIMATS, successfully organised a One-Day International Seminar on “Between Regulation and Risk: Intersection of Law, Public Health and Socio-Economic Vulnerabilities of Women Sex Workers” on 30th April 2026 at the New Moot Court Hall.
The National Conference on “Entrepreneurship for Inclusive and Sustainable Economic Growth” organized by the Centre for Law and Economics, Saveetha School of Law, SIMATS, on 3rd April, 2026 brought together academicians and scholars to deliberate on contemporary entrepreneurial challenges and opportunities. On 7 March 2026, an International Conference titled “Beyond Control: The Black Hole Effect of the Internet on Copyright Ownership and Enforcement” was successfully organised, bringing together academicians, legal professionals, researchers, and students to discuss contemporary challenges in copyright law within the rapidly evolving digital ecosystem.
The Department of Labour Law and the Department of Humanities and Social Sciences successfully organized an International Conference on Work Life Harmony on 4 March 2026. The conference aimed to discuss and compare the concept of work life harmony in India and abroad.
The One Day National Seminar on “Understanding Rare Disease Policy and Healthcare Regulations in India” was organized by Ms. Swathi G, Research Scholar on 28.2.26 in Saveetha School of Law. There were 190 enthusiastic participants including students, researchers, academicians, and healthcare law enthusiasts, reflecting the increasing academic and social concern toward rare disease policy and regulatory frameworks in India.
The Department of Constitution Law and the Department of Management, Saveetha School of Law, SIMATS, successfully organised a National Seminar on “Evolving Brand Protection: Fluid Trademarks, Innovation, and Legal Governance in the Post-Pandemic Era” on 16 February 2026.
